Output 903a4fe878d373e45659ad7131f32d8363916473f0af1effd38c382fa65e32a3:29

value
15128360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91db9b76ca8ddacd2be1e5159bb17c089431e71 OP_EQUAL
address
3MV2AXoAnKpm6C9w9LncTTo73kV37Qc7c8
transaction
903a4fe878d373e45659ad7131f32d8363916473f0af1effd38c382fa65e32a3
spent
true